The Start of something special.
All journeys start somewhere and for Royal Alloy it is the GT 125i AC.

At just 130KG the plastic bodied GT is aimed at the mainstream customer who appreciates a classic looking machine with modern Reliability and Quality.

A punchy 9.5 BHP 2valve SOHC engine beats at the heart of the base model giving more than enough power for the majority of users, a generous 1390mm of wheel base combined with 110/70/12 & 120/70/12 profile tyres amply dampened front and rear by 4 shock absorbers, gives a sturdy, responsive feel that belies the value for money price tag.
